The Aruba 8325-32C Layer 3 Switch is engineered to unify campus and data center networking under one, modern platform. Built to excel in the mobile, cloud, and IoT era, this switch acts as a robust core and aggregation switch for campus networks while also serving as a top-of-rack (ToR) powerhouse in data centers. With ArubaOS-CX at its core, the 8325-32C delivers a modern software experience that blends high performance with intelligent automation, giving IT teams the tools they need to scale securely and efficiently. This solution is purpose-built for organizations seeking lower operational costs, faster deployment cycles, and a resilient network that can adapt to evolving traffic patterns and security requirements. Whether you’re consolidating campus edge access, supporting dense server connectivity, or enabling advanced data center automation, the Aruba 8325-32C provides a flexible, future-proof foundation.

Engineered for high-density, multi-tenant environments, the 8325-32C brings together advanced L3 routing, robust switching, and intelligent analytics in a single platform. Its design emphasizes low latency and predictable performance, ensuring smooth experiences for latency-sensitive applications such as real-time collaboration, AI-driven analytics, and enterprise workloads. The switch’s software-based intelligence helps network operators anticipate issues before they impact users, while its scalable architecture supports growing traffic volumes, new virtualization schemes, and expansive cloud integrations. The Aruba 8325-32C is more than a traditional switch; it’s a platform for intent-based networking that aligns with modern IT operations and security paradigms, enabling you to define and enforce policies that follow devices and users across wired and wireless networks.

how to install HPE 8325-32C Layer 3 Switch

Installing the Aruba 8325-32C involves a few core steps that set the foundation for reliable, scalable network performance. Begin by mounting the switch in a standard 19-inch rack, ensuring proper airflow and clearance for cooling and access to front-panel ports. Once the chassis is securely installed, connect the power supply and verify that power is stable before proceeding. Place the device in a suitable network location where cable runs can be organized and labeled for ongoing maintenance. After physical installation, you’ll want to perform an initial configuration to establish basic management access and routing policies.

For initial configuration, connect a management workstation to the console port or to the out-of-band management interface if available. Use the console or the web-based UI to set an administrative password, configure management IP settings, and enable secure access controls. From there, establish VLANs, basic L2 connectivity, and L3 routing primitives such as static routes and dynamic routing protocols as required by your topology. ArubaOS-CX supports RESTful APIs and programmatic interfaces, so you can automate deployment through orchestration tools, Puppet/Ansible playbooks, or custom scripts to apply consistent configurations across devices. If you’re integrating the switch into an existing Aruba environment, you can leverage Aruba Central or your preferred network management platform to push configurations, collect telemetry, and monitor performance in real time.

When integrating with campus networks or data center fabric, plan for appropriate QoS policies, security profiles, and segmentation strategies. Define traffic classes for latency-sensitive workloads, ensure that critical services receive priority, and apply security policies that minimize exposure to potential threats. For firmware and software updates, follow vendor-approved procedures to minimize downtime and ensure compatibility with adjacent devices. Finally, validate the traffic paths, verify routing tables, and perform a baseline performance test to verify that the switch meets your expected throughput and latency targets before moving into production operation.
